Responsibilities

Relationships & Communication
• Own all owner relationships: Build rapport, anticipate needs, and address issues before they become requests. Respond to all communications promptly and lead with solutions
• Maintain productive tenant relationships through proactive communication, renewal management, and confident handling of difficult conversations

Financial Management
• Review property financials regularly to ensure adequate operating cash and reserves
• Prepare annual budgets and monitor actuals to keep expenses on track
• Review and approve operating expenses per company policy
• Assist in determining CAM expenses, review CAM reconciliations, and field tenant CAM questions

Projects & Capital Work
• Bid, negotiate, and present recommendations for tenant improvements, repairs, and renovations
• Oversee approved construction projects from kickoff to closeout; on scope, on budget, on time
• Troubleshoot operational issues, identify improvement opportunities, and bring recommendations to management

Leasing & Compliance
• Interpret and apply commercial lease terms, CAM language, and lease calculations with precision
• Support the leasing team and brokers through negotiations, including tenant improvement scoping and costing
• Enforce lease compliance and manage delinquency

Property Operations
• Conduct regular property visits and inspections to verify maintenance standards and confirm building systems are fully functional
• Field after-hours emergency calls and coordinate vendor dispatch with the Operations team
• Ensure work orders are completed and property conditions are documented accurately

Requirements and Qualifications
• 2-5 years of commercial property management experience.
• Reliable Transportation and a valid Driver's License.
• Working knowledge and understanding of operating costs, budgeting and related expense control preferred.
